Today, the legend of Ibiza lives on and party-goers continue to flock to its sun-drenched shores every summer to escape the pull of reality. But the island’s heydey – responsible for its now legendary status – was back in the early ‘80s when idealists and counter-culturalists sought solace in Ibiza's free-spirited culture and euphoric sound. With a heritage deeply informed by the music community, British menswear brand Farah has drawn inspiration from the spirit and the aesthetic of the “White Isle” for its high summer collection.

A sartorial take on the melodic sound of Ibiza, the drop draws cues from the island's inclusive spirit as a whole and to its legendary beat in particular. Pioneered by DJ Alfredo, the Balearic rhythm reflects the island's "anything goes" mentality, fusing elements from various genres of music – from reggae to rock – with melodic synthesized beats.  This liberal state of mind is shared by Farah, whose skillfully tailored, durable, and inexpensive styles have served as a common thread for a diversity subcultures since the ‘70s.

The collection delivers a range of timeless silhouettes that channel a British feel including polo shirts, shorts, tees, sweaters, pants, and swimwear. Informed by the Balearic coastline, the color palette offers up sun-bleached pinks, greens, and blues, which are punctuated by neon accents that recall the bright lights of Ibiza’s famed superclubs. Known for its liberal use of prints, Farah highlights key pieces in the collection with a pattern resembling Terrazzo stone, a material used frequently in Balearic architecture.
